San Marcos de Colón is located in the southern region of Honduras, positioned at GPS coordinates 13.43333, -86.8. It lies within the timezone of America/Tegucigalpa, which is Central Standard Time (CST). This city is part of the Choluteca department and is known for its agricultural activities, particularly in coffee and livestock.

The city serves as a trade hub for surrounding rural areas, providing essential services and markets for local farmers. San Marcos de Colón is also recognized for its vibrant cultural traditions, contributing to the regional identity of southern Honduras. Its strategic location makes it significant for commerce and community engagement in the region.

Timezone in San Marcos de Colón

San Marcos de Colón is located in the America/Tegucigalpa timezone, which has a UTC offset of -6 hours. This means that the local time is six hours behind Coordinated Universal Time. Unlike some regions, San Marcos de Colón does not observe daylight saving time, maintaining the same UTC offset throughout the year.

Practical Information for Visitors

San Marcos de Colón is accessible primarily by bus, with services connecting it to larger cities like Tegucigalpa and Choluteca. There are no major airports nearby, so flying into Tegucigalpa or San Pedro Sula and then taking a bus is the most common route. The region has a tropical climate, characterized by a wet season from May to October, which can bring heavy rain, and a dry season from November to April, making the latter the most favorable time for visits.

Temperatures in San Marcos de Colón typically hover between 20 to 30 degrees Celsius. The best time to visit is during the dry season when outdoor activities and local festivals occur, providing a more enjoyable experience. Practical tips for visitors include staying hydrated and using insect repellent due to the warm climate.

It’s also wise to have cash on hand, as many local businesses may not accept credit cards. Engaging with local residents can enhance your experience, as they can provide insights into the culture and places worth exploring.
